On 1 January 2022, Rodney Inc. provided services to Smith Co. in exchange for Smith’s $300,000, 2-year 8% note with interest compounded semi-annually on July 1 and January 1. The current market rate of similar notes is 12%. Rodney Inc. financial year ends December 31.
